Ryan Reynolds Praises “Fearless” Blake Lively Days After Justin Baldoni Settlement

Ryan Reynolds had an extra special Mother's Day tribute to Blake Lively

After the Deadpool star penned an emotional shoutout to the Gossip Girl alum—whom he shares kids James, 11, Inez, 9, Betty, 6, and Olin, 3, with—Blake had the best reaction. 

As she wrote over a repost of Ryan’s kind words alongside a heart-faced emoji on Instagram Stories May 10, “I happen to be pretty fond of you too.”

As for what Ryan said of his wife of 13 years in the Mother’s Day message?

“I appreciate this mother beyond measure,” he wrote on Instagram stories alongside two snaps of the couple enjoying time in nature. “She is kind. She is fearless. She’s the absolute love of my life—and to our four little kids, she’s the life of their love.”

One week earlier, Blake returned to the 2026 Met Gala hours after news broke of her settlement deal with her It Ends With Us director and costar Justin Baldoni following their yearslong legal battle.

At the event, the mom of four shared how she was keeping her little ones close with a special fashion choice.

“This is a Judith Leiber bag,” the 38-year-old shared with Vogue, “and we were trying to find a piece of famous iconic art to put on and make it look like it's in a frame.”

“Then I said, ‘If you're gonna do it custom, can you do my kids' art?’ So my kids each painted a watercolor painting,” Blake continued. “Each of my four kids did this. Isn't that special? So I have them with me."

Photo by Dimitrios Kambouris/Getty Images

And though they couldn’t be there in-person, The Shallows star shared how her kids gave her the strength she needed to step out at fashion’s biggest night. 

"I'm shy too, I just like to have my kids with me,” she explained. “I probably could've fit them under my dress to be honest."

In addition to holding her little ones close, Blake has also leaned on Ryan for support amid her legal battle, who has been by her side every step of the way. 

"I’ve never in my life been more proud of my wife,” Ryan said April 19 on Today's Sunday Sitdown Live with Willie Geist. "People have no idea what’s really going on, you know?"

"And I’ve just never in my life been more proud of someone with that level of integrity that brings that with them," he added, "and carries that with them in everything that they do."
